Abstract
The utility model discloses a kind of guy-wire-knockout electric connectors, including connector body, the side of the connector body is fixedly connected with bracing wire, there are two side plates for the side fixed installation of connector body, two side plate sides close to each other are slidably fitted with rectangle seat, two rectangle seat sides close to each other are fixedly connected with bracing wire, rectangle seat is welded with rectangular slab far from the side of connector body, two side plate sides close to each other are slidably fitted with movable plate, two side plate sides close to each other are fixedly installed with fixed board, multiple first springs are welded between movable plate and corresponding fixed board, two side plate sides close to each other offer turn trough, shaft is rotatably equipped in turn trough.The case where the utility model practicability is good, and the first spring and second spring provide certain cushion effect, and plug and socket when pulling force is excessive on connector is effectively prevented to be damaged.
